What Exactly Happened
The Asus Bike Booster is an intelligent device that attaches to a bicycle, providing cyclists with critical real-time data such as speed, distance, and cadence. What sets it apart, however, is its ability to monitor the cyclist’s environment, offering alerts for potential hazards, suggesting optimal gear shifts, and even providing post-ride analysis to help improve future performances.
